Olustee-Eldorado Public School and the planning committee recommends budgeting the remaining funds in the following areas. This is not an exhausted list, and may be revised through community collaboration with Olustee-Eldorado Public School stakeholders.
1) Inspection, testing, maintenance, repair, replacement, and upgrade projects to improve the indoor air quality in school facilities, including mechanical and non-mechanical heating, ventilation, and air conditioning systems, filtering, purification and other air cleaning, fans, control systems, and window and door repair and replacement.
2) Purchasing educational technology (including hardware, software, and connectivity) for students who are served by the local educational agency that aids in regular and substantive educational interaction between students and their classroom instructors, including low-income students and children with disabilities, which may include assistive technology or adaptive equipment.
3) Purchasing supplies to sanitize and clean the facilities of a local educational agency, including buildings operated
4) Activities to address the unique needs of low-income children or students, children with disabilities, English learners, racial and ethnic minorities, students experiencing homelessness, and foster care youth, including how outreach and service delivery will meet the needs of each population including transportation to and from Summer Academy
5) administering and using high-quality assessments that are valid and reliable, to accurately assess students’ academic progress and assist educators in meeting students’ academic needs, including through differentiating instruction.
6) Providing information and assistance to parents and families on how they can effectively support students, including in a distance learning environment.
7) Providing opportunities for vaccinations for families and
8) other activities that are necessary to maintain the operation of and continuity of services in local educational agencies and continuing to employ existing staff of the local educational agency.
9) Purchase of touchless sinks and toilets to prevent the spread of COVID-19 and other infectious diseases by reducing contact with common surfaces.
10) Purchase of intercom system to facilitate messages to campus concerning closures, changes of schedules, and other information related to COVID-19 exposures.
